1
0
mirror of https://github.com/Bayselonarrend/OpenIntegrations.git synced 2026-05-22 10:05:29 +02:00
Files
OpenIntegrations/docs/ru/md/Airtable/Record-management/Create-posts.md
T
Vitaly the Alpaca (bot) caf29be3bc Main build (Jenkins)
2024-10-07 21:57:35 +03:00

2.5 KiB

sidebar_position
sidebar_position
3

Создать записи

Создает одну или массив записей по описанию или массиву описаний значений полей

Функция СоздатьЗаписи(Знач Токен, Знач База, Знач Таблица, Знач Данные) Экспорт

Параметр CLI опция Тип Назначение
Токен --token Строка Токен
База --base Строка Идентификатор базы данных
Таблица --table Строка Идентификатор таблицы
Данные --data Структура, Массив из Структура Набор или массив наборов пар Ключ : Значение > Поле : Показатель

Возвращаемое значение: Соответствие Из КлючИЗначение - сериализованный JSON ответа от Airtable


    Токен   = "patNn4BXW66Yx3pdj.5b93c53cab554a8387de02d...";
    База    = "app9bSgL4YtTVGTlE";
    Таблица = "tblDUGAZFZaeOwE6x";

    Номер     = 10;
    Строковое = "Привет";

    ОписаниеСтроки1 = Новый Структура("Номер,Строковое", Номер, Строковое);
    ОписаниеСтроки2 = Новый Структура("Номер,Строковое", Номер, Строковое);

    МассивОписаний  = Новый Массив;
    МассивОписаний.Добавить(ОписаниеСтроки1);
    МассивОписаний.Добавить(ОписаниеСтроки2);

    Результат = OPI_Airtable.СоздатьЗаписи(Токен, База, Таблица, МассивОписаний);
    
  oint airtable СоздатьЗаписи --token %token% --base "apptm8Xqo7TwMaipQ" --table "tbl9G4jVoTJpxYwSY" --data %data%

{
 "records": [
  {
   "id": "recoSzuMRt0P5t4tX",
   "createdTime": "2024-10-07T18:42:10Z",
   "fields": {
    "Номер": 10,
    "Строковое": "Привет\n"
   }
  },
  {
   "id": "recAUwihV9qUfhMEi",
   "createdTime": "2024-10-07T18:42:10Z",
   "fields": {
    "Номер": 10,
    "Строковое": "Привет\n"
   }
  }
 ]
}